QUOTE (bmags @ Jul 8, 2014 -> 10:40 AM) You face cap penalties if a player retires early? Only the players who signed the mega cap-avoiding deals before the new CBA. From 2017-18 to 2020-21 (age 39 to 42), Hossa'a salary will be $1 million a year. The new CBA punishes teams if a player retires during that portion of the contract, which was the original plan. -
